Nebraska Department of Health and Human Services https://qic-wd.ddev.site/taxonomy/term/14/all en Nebraska Summary https://qic-wd.ddev.site/nebraska-summary <div class="field field-name-body field-type-text-with-summary field-label-hidden"><div class="field-items"><div class="field-item even" property="content:encoded"><h3>Building a Resilient Workforce</h3> <p>Nebraska Division of Child and Family Services (DCFS) is a state-operated child welfare system. The Division is housed in the Department of Health and Human services and is divided into five service areas. DCFS has about 400 frontline child welfare workers (Child and Family Services Specialists or CFSS), 70 supervisors, and 15 field administrators. In 2017, DCFS had an annual <a href="/nebraska-site-overview">turnover rate</a> of about 30%. They applied to be a QIC-WD site with the goal of strengthening their child welfare workforce. </p></div></div></div> Mon, 25 Sep 2023 20:00:51 +0000 admin 848 at https://qic-wd.ddev.site The Restoring Resiliency Response(R) : Addressing Work-related Trauma in Nebraska https://qic-wd.ddev.site/restoring-resiliency-responser-addressing-work-related-trauma-nebraska <span, h6><a href="/restoring-resiliency-responser-addressing-work-related-trauma-nebraska">The Restoring Resiliency Response(R) : Addressing Work-related Trauma in Nebraska </a></span, h6><br><p>Restoring Resiliency Response <span>®</span> is being piloted in Nebraska to address work-related traumatic stress through therapeutic sessions.</p> <a href="/restoring-resiliency-responser-addressing-work-related-trauma-nebraska" class="">Watch the Video</a><hr><a href="/restoring-resiliency-responser-addressing-work-related-trauma-nebraska"><img typeof="foaf:Image" src="https://qic-wd.ddev.site/sites/default/files/styles/medium/public/video_embed_field_thumbnails/vimeo/859130821.?itok=IPifqRgL" alt="" /></a> Tue, 29 Aug 2023 19:34:44 +0000 admin 837 at https://qic-wd.ddev.site Nebraska Key Findings https://qic-wd.ddev.site/nebraska-key-findings <div class="field field-name-body field-type-text-with-summary field-label-hidden"><div class="field-items"><div class="field-item even" property="content:encoded"><h3>Background</h3> </div></div></div> Thu, 29 Jun 2023 16:42:21 +0000 admin 819 at https://qic-wd.ddev.site Nebraska Needs Assessment Summary https://qic-wd.ddev.site/nebraska-needs-assessment-summary <div class="field field-name-body field-type-text-with-summary field-label-hidden"><div class="field-items"><div class="field-item even" property="content:encoded"><h3>Exploration of Needs</h3> </div></div></div> Tue, 07 Jun 2022 17:29:22 +0000 admin 732 at https://qic-wd.ddev.site Nebraska Intervention Background https://qic-wd.ddev.site/nebraska-intervention-background <div class="field field-name-body field-type-text-with-summary field-label-hidden"><div class="field-items"><div class="field-item even" property="content:encoded"><h3>What is Secondary Traumatic Stress (STS) and why was an intervention designed to address it?</h3> </div></div></div> Thu, 10 Feb 2022 16:16:38 +0000 admin 703 at https://qic-wd.ddev.site Nebraska Theory of Change https://qic-wd.ddev.site/nebraska-theory-change <div class="field field-name-body field-type-text-with-summary field-label-hidden"><div class="field-items"><div class="field-item even" property="content:encoded"><p>Several workforce challenges were discussed as opportunities for intervention during the needs assessment  process conducted partnership with the Nebraska Department of Children and Family Services’ (DCFS) to address child welfare workforce turnover.</p></div></div></div> Thu, 18 Nov 2021 23:46:23 +0000 admin 679 at https://qic-wd.ddev.site Secondary Traumatic Stress (STS) – Its Impact on the Child Welfare Workforce and Strategies for Agencies to Address It https://qic-wd.ddev.site/blog/secondary-traumatic-stress-impact-child-welfare-workforce-and-strategies-agencies <div class="field field-name-field-blog-thumbnail field-type-image field-label-hidden"><div class="field-items"><div class="field-item even"><a href="/blog/secondary-traumatic-stress-impact-child-welfare-workforce-and-strategies-agencies"><img typeof="foaf:Image" src="https://qic-wd.ddev.site/sites/default/files/styles/medium/public/stresstrauma.jpg?itok=otCbkzhy" width="220" height="146" alt="" /></a></div></div></div><span, h3><a href="/blog/secondary-traumatic-stress-impact-child-welfare-workforce-and-strategies-agencies">Secondary Traumatic Stress (STS) – Its Impact on the Child Welfare Workforce and Strategies for Agencies to Address It</a></span, h3><br><small class="field field-name-post-date field-type-ds field-label-inline clearfix" ><span class="label-inline" >Posted on </span>November 2, 2021</small><div class="field field-name-field-teaser field-type-text field-label-hidden"><div class="field-items"><div class="field-item even">Secondary Traumatic Stress (STS) impacts both child welfare workers and agencies. CFS Strong included multiple components:</p></div></div></div> Mon, 28 Jun 2021 19:18:48 +0000 admin 627 at https://qic-wd.ddev.site Nebraska Site Overview https://qic-wd.ddev.site/nebraska-site-overview <div class="field field-name-body field-type-text-with-summary field-label-hidden"><div class="field-items"><div class="field-item even" property="content:encoded"><p> The Nebraska Department of Health and Human Services (DHHS) is a multi-service agency led by a Chief Executive Officer (CEO), who is appointed by the Governor.  The CEO oversees six divisions including the Division of Children and Family Services (DCFS), which is the state’s child welfare agency. The divisions are supported by centralized operations that include Human Resources (HR) &amp; Development. HR has at least one individual with a strong working knowledge of DCFS operations and who is specifically assigned to provide support solely to DCFS.</p></div></div></div> Wed, 23 Jun 2021 20:15:47 +0000 admin 614 at https://qic-wd.ddev.site Nebraska Site Intervention Logic Model https://qic-wd.ddev.site/nebraska-site-intervention-logic-model <div class="field field-name-body field-type-text-with-summary field-label-hidden"><div class="field-items"><div class="field-item even" property="content:encoded"><p>Each QIC-WD site developed a logic model to serve as a visual representation of their selected intervention.
